Output 4c58f12ebb2d45ebeb196e043f367d0c42b9e7bf3bf92d8a90eac5536fca8e99:1

value
124483
script pubkey
OP_0 OP_PUSHBYTES_20 43e3b50353c5e6d79a01814f0a4a15c46ee363c2
address
bc1qg03m2q6nchnd0xsps98s5js4c3hwxc7zmws94d
transaction
4c58f12ebb2d45ebeb196e043f367d0c42b9e7bf3bf92d8a90eac5536fca8e99
confirmations
42319
spent
true